D.B. Concrete Takes Liebherr Truckmixer and Conveyor “Combi”

D.B. Concrete runs a fleet of concrete truckmixers in the Colchester area and, for a number of years, has successfully operated a truckmixer-mounted conveyor. Company owner Dave Baxter says "We only keep our vehicles for five years and, in a replacement programme this year, we've gone for two new Liebherr truckmixers - a 7m³ and an 8m³ model - taking the larger HTM 804L truckmixer with a new conveyor, which is our first from Liebherr. We analysed the results of our returns on conveyed concrete and looked at a number of options. What attracted us to the Liebherr equipment was the integrated nature of this combination, its versatility and the build quality". Having seen two similar units on a visit to the Mercedes factory and been impressed with what he saw, Dave Baxter placed the order with Liebherr-Great Britain and the vehicle is already proving to be a wise and profitable investment. "At D.B. Concrete", continues Mr Baxter "we like to offer a range of readymix delivery systems to our local customer base. This includes added benefits such as 9m extended chutes and we also run a concrete pump. This new conveyor fills the distance gap for accurate and efficient delivery of concrete and is a real sales and marketing asset in maintaining our hard-earned reputation for versatility on the many sites in the area to which we deliver".
The Liebherr LTB 12+4+1 truckmixer conveyor is capable of reaching between 11.2 and 16.2 metres, featuring a middle and head telescoping section for precise placement. Conveying height can be up to 7.5 metres and conveying depth down to 6 metres. With a belt width of 360mm and a variable belt speed of up to 3.5m/second (the belt is driven by hydraulic pump complete with load sensing), the LTB conveyor can place up to 70m³ per hour and the entire conveyor can slew between 160º and 240º. For complete stability during discharge and placement, the LTB comes equipped with hydraulically controlled rear outriggers, ensuring that the entire vehicle is both stable and level.
For operational convenience, accuracy and safety, D.B. Concrete has taken the Liebherr conveyor with an optional wireless remote control system. This allows the driver to activate both the truckmixer drum and conveyor remotely, providing control of all belt functions, the discharge chute, vehicle engine on/off and stepless regulation of the drum speed. An emergency button immediately de-activates the entire operation if required.
